If you are planning to buy a car immediately after landed then take an International Driving License usually issued by travel agents(I am not sure about Bangladesh) against your Bangladeshi license, that license has the validity of 6 months.
About car, personally I suggest Toyota Corolla or Camry is much better if you could afford. BUT VERY CAREFUL DURING WINTER TIME. In case of any accident you need to pay high insurance. I recommend do not drive during first 6 months.

Sorry !! Its not BRTA office. Actually its the office of a Barrister who is affiliated by BRTA to certify international driving license. Its opposite to Moghbazar Agora and before Bishal center shopping mall. He charges 2000 BDT for giving the certificate and takes 2 weeks time. PLEASE DONT TAKE THIS CERTIFICATE WHO HAVE LESS THAN 2 YEARS DRIVING EXPERIENCE. IT WILL ONLY WASTE YOUR MONEY.

by the way

here is the procedure to get international driving license from MOTOR DRIVING ASSOCIATION OF BANGLADESH :-

Collect Application form from . . . Motor driving Association of Bangladesh, 3/2 Outer Circular Road, Mogbazar, Tel : +880 2 8311492 (Office time, 10am - 3pm, weekdays).

Submit Application with 4 copies of Photo ( 1 Passport size + 3 Stamp Size) along with..

Photocopy of Driving License/License receipt

Application Fee 2500Tk.

Photocopy of Passport.

I hope it will be helpful for all
